SHANGHAIWorldwide Energy and Manufacturing USA announced record first quarter revenue and net income, on new orders and acquisitions.
 
Net sales were nearly $10.3 million, up 47.4% compared to 2008. The increase is attributable to energy orders and the recent acquisition of Shanghai Intech-Detron Electric and Electronic Co.

SALISBURY, NCHenkel Corp. will consolidate certain electronics adhesive manufacturing operations into its plant here, the company said. The company plans to invest more than $23.7 million and to create 103 jobs during the next three years.
